Johnson Family Cinnamon Rolls

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
20 minutes
Total Time:
150 minutes
Create quick and delicious cinnamon rolls using a bread machine for easy dough preparation before baking to perfection in the oven.
Ingredients:
  • 1 cup water
  • 3 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 tablespoons nonfat dry milk powder
  • 3.5 tablespoons white s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 teaspoons active dry yeast
  • 0.33333334326744 cup white sugar
  • 0.75 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 3 tablespoons butter, softened
Instructions:
  • Add water, oil, dry milk powder, 3 1/2 tablespoons sugar, salt, flour, and yeast to the bread machine following the manufacturer's instructions. Select the Dough cycle and once finished, transfer the dough to a floured work surface.
  • Combine the 1/3 cup of sugar with cinnamon in a bowl, and set it aside. Grease a 9x13 inch pan with cooking spray.
  • Roll out the dough into a 10x15 inch rectangle. Spread the softened butter evenly over the dough and sprinkle with the sugar-cinnamon mixture. Roll the dough into a tight roll from the long side. Cut into 12 slices about 3/4 inch thick and place in the prepared baking pan, ensuring they are close together. Cover with a cloth and let rise in a warm place for 30 to 60 minutes, until doubled in size.
  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) to ensure the perfect cooking temperature.
  • Bake the rolls in the preheated oven until golden brown on top, for 15 to 20 minutes.
